Israel’s Military Might:⁤ Unveiling the Arsenal

Let’s delve into the sheer magnitude of Israel’s military⁤ as it confronts its most significant conflict in half a‍ century:

  • Israel’s army boasts an impressive arsenal,⁤ including 2,200 tanks and⁢ 530 artillery units. It⁢ comprises ⁣169,500 active military members and ​465,000⁢ reserves ‌during peacetime. Notably, there are currently 300,000 soldiers stationed near the ‌Gaza Strip⁣ border.
  • On the naval front, Israel⁢ possesses five submarines and ‌49 patrol and coastal ships. Additionally, the country ⁤flaunts 339 combat aircraft,⁢ including 309‍ fighter jets, ​along with 142 helicopters. Notably, Israel is‌ home to the renowned Iron ‍Dome air defense system,⁤ a stalwart shield against incoming rockets.

The Iron Dome: A Shield Against Threats

The Iron Dome stands as⁣ a network of radars and missile launchers, ​skillfully employed by Israel to detect‌ and intercept⁢ short-range⁤ rockets⁤ aimed at sensitive or civilian ⁢areas. Developed by two Israeli companies​ with support from the United ⁢States, this system has achieved an astounding success rate of up to ​90%. Its deployment dates back to 2011.

Strategically positioned ‌near densely populated regions and cities, ⁤the Iron Dome ‌encompasses 10 batteries. Each battery comprises three to four⁣ launchers, capable of holding up‍ to 20 interceptors. Remarkably, ‌a single ⁣battery can safeguard ‍an ‌area spanning 60 square miles,⁤ detecting rockets up to 43 miles away.

Israel’s Military Expenditure: A‍ Staggering Investment

In 2022 alone, Israel allocated a staggering $23.4‌ billion to its military, according to the Stockholm International ⁤Peace Research Institute. This⁤ translates ​to a per capita expenditure of⁢ $2,535 from 2018-2022, ⁢making Israel the second highest spender globally, surpassed ⁤only by Qatar ‌and followed closely by ​the United States. During the same period, ⁢the United States spent $2,101 per person ‌on ⁤its military, while Qatar proportionately allocated $3,379.

Service in Israel’s Armed Forces:⁤ A National Obligation

Israel mandates that every resident ​over 18 serves in ⁢its armed forces, irrespective of‌ gender.​ Men are expected to ​serve a minimum of ⁤32 months, while women are⁤ required to serve 24 months. Following active​ duty, service members‌ can transition to⁤ the reserves, where they ‍may remain⁣ until approximately 40 or 50 years old, depending on their role.

Nuclear Capabilities:​ A Last Resort

While Israeli officials‍ neither confirm nor deny the ‌existence of nuclear weapons, it is widely believed⁤ that⁣ the country ‌possesses 80-90 nuclear ‌warheads. However, these ⁣weapons are reserved​ for dire circumstances when the nation’s future hangs in‍ the balance. Israeli military doctrine dictates that ‌nuclear weapons should serve as a “final deterrent.”

United⁣ States: A Key Ally in Israel’s Defense

The United States plays⁣ a pivotal role in bolstering Israel’s defense capabilities. From⁢ 2018-2022, the‍ U.S. ‍sent $2.1 ⁢billion worth ‍of equipment ⁤to Israel, while also purchasing defense items from the country,⁤ totaling $217 million⁢ during the same period. Additionally,⁢ the U.S. provides $3.8 ​billion‍ in⁣ annual military aid as part of a⁤ 10-year agreement⁤ signed under former President Barack Obama in 2016.

In the ongoing conflict with Hamas, the U.S. has pledged support ‍by replenishing ⁢the Iron Dome with missiles ‌and‌ dispatching munitions to Israel. Furthermore,⁣ additional Air Force fighter ​aircraft squadrons, including F-35, F-15, F-16, and ⁤A-10, have been deployed in the region.

Approval for further aid from the United States is anticipated, ⁤although ‍the timeline remains uncertain⁢ due to ongoing leadership changes⁤ within the House of Representatives.

Technological Advancements: ‌Shaping the⁤ Battlefield

Israel ‍has gained global recognition for its advancements in​ military technology. The nation invests ​heavily in research and development, resulting in⁤ the creation of cutting-edge systems ‌and innovative solutions.

One notable example is Israel’s use of unmanned aerial vehicles ​(UAVs) or drones. These sophisticated ‍machines ​provide⁢ real-time intelligence, surveillance, and reconnaissance capabilities, enabling Israel to gather crucial information without risking the lives of its soldiers.‍ Israel’s expertise in drone technology is unmatched,⁢ and its UAVs have become ⁤an integral part of ⁢its defense strategy.

Additionally, Israel has made significant strides in the field of cyber warfare. The ​country⁤ has developed robust cybersecurity measures, protecting its critical infrastructure and networks from cyber threats. With cyber warfare becoming an increasingly potent‌ weapon in modern conflicts, Israel’s expertise in this domain further strengthens its defense capabilities.

The Importance of Defense in a Volatile ‍Region

Israel’s robust defense capabilities are not solely a result ‍of ⁣its​ desire for military supremacy. The nation’s long history of conflict ‌and its unique ⁢geopolitical position dictate the necessity ‌for a‌ powerful defense force. ‍Surrounded by nations with unstable political climates and hostile relations, Israel faces significant security threats. It ‍is imperative for Israel to maintain a credible⁢ deterrent to ensure its security and deter potential aggressors.

Furthermore, Israel’s commitment to its defense capabilities extends beyond protecting its own borders. ‌The nation provides assistance and expertise to countries facing similar security challenges. Israel’s defense cooperation agreements with various nations have helped build strong alliances and foster international security cooperation.
